Defenseman Grant Clitsome and the Columbus Blue Jackets agreed to a new two-year contract on Friday, the financial terms of which were not released.

The 26-year-old Clitsome, a ninth-round pick in the 2004 Entry Draft, contributed 4 goals, 19 points and a plus-2 rating in 31 NHL games this past season. He ranked second among Columbus defensemen in ice time at 21:16 per game. Clitsome also had 5 goals and 15 points in 32 AHL games with Springfield.

"We are pleased to have Grant signed for two more years," Blue Jackets General Manager Scott Howson said in a press release. "He is a great example of a player we drafted who has patiently developed at the collegiate and AHL levels and become a solid, dependable NHL defenseman."

Clitsome has 5 goals and 22 points in 42 career games with the Blue Jackets.
